  • the innovation relates to a cuboid packaging container according to the preamble of claim 1.
  • Packaging containers which are often used as shipping boxes, are usually sealed with an adhesive tape. Aids (knives, scissors) must be used to open these containers, which has the disadvantage that the packaging material is damaged when opened improperly and there is a risk of injury to the person from the opening aids.
  • packaging containers which are described for example in DE 25 33 205 and 29 46 014, contain notches or perforation lines as opening aids for the packaging. There is a risk that these lines of weakness tear open during transport and that the contents will be damaged. In addition, it is necessary that, in one of the packaging containers mentioned, only the lid can be opened after opening, that extra finger cutouts are formed in the side walls in order to remove the contents of the packaging, for example magnetic tape cassettes.
  • packaging containers with tear strips are known from the prior art, described for example in DE-GM 16 68 076, DE-OS 31 40 389 and 35 08 093 and EP 0 199 225, in which the tear strips are partially connected with pull tabs for tearing open the packaging.
  • the innovation was based on the task of developing a simply constructed packaging container with an integrated opening mechanism, which enables opening without tools and without risk of injury to the person or the goods to be packaged, and which, in a preferred embodiment, is suitable for shipping stacked tape rolls.
  • the tabs of the side walls (3, 4) and the side wall (3) contain weakening lines perforated (9, 9 ', 10, 10', 11) approximately in their geometric center as predetermined breaking lines.
  • two stamped tabs (5, 6) are formed on at least one side wall (3) between the predetermined breaking lines, each of which is provided with an extension (5 ', 6') in the direction of the edges (7, 8) of the container.
  • the predetermined breaking line (10, 10 ') is formed on the side wall (4) only on the side tabs.
  • a groove (18, 18 ') or crease line is formed between the tab and its extension.
  • the container is closed by an adhesive tape (12) (FIG. 3) starting at the extension (5 ') of the tab (5) all the way to the three side walls up to the extension (6') of the second tab (6 ) is glued, the side flaps (13, 13 ', 14, 14') are each connected to one another. Only the predetermined breaking point (11) is exposed.
  • the width of the adhesive tape is the same or slightly wider than the width of the tabs (5, 6).
  • the procedure for opening the new packaging container is as follows. First, one of the tabs is pushed in or pierced with your finger. "PRESS" can be printed on the tabs to clarify handling. Then the tab can be gripped through the resulting grip hole. Behind the flap there should be a small cavity about the width of your hand or finger. The tab is now gripped and pulled out. The tape, which is attached to the extension of the flap, is pulled up and can be easily separated from the packaging container. This opens one side of the packaging container. The same procedure is followed with the second tab. The packaging container is thus open on both sides.
  • the packaging container can now be opened at the predetermined breaking point (11), so that the packaging container can now be opened like a book and the exposed packaging contents can be removed with ease (FIG. 4).
  • Another advantage is that the opened packaging container, which no longer has any residual tension, lies flat and can therefore be disposed of more easily. The previous tedious tearing of the containers for waste disposal is therefore no longer necessary for the end user.
  • the packaging container according to the innovation can be used in a preferred manner for the dispatch of finished tape rolls or stacked pancakes, for example for magnetic tapes, since it is cylindrical Shape enables a cavity to be located inside the packaging container behind the tabs.
  • cuboid objects can also be used advantageously in the container according to the invention. In this case there can be a cavity behind the flap, for example, which is created by a cardboard intermediate layer.
  • the material for the new packaging container can be cardboard or corrugated cardboard, and the cardboard material can also be laminated with a plastic coating.
